This is a descriptive, exploratory case research that intends to analyze a non-directed interaction of a nurse with a schizophrenia female patient. The interaction was recorded, transcribed and subjected to thematic analysis. We have identified five themes, which were discussed based on the scientific literature on interpersonal relationship and non-directed assistance. The results have showed us the importance of listening, genuine interest and professional availability, that, when recognized by the patient, provide identifying and addressing their real needs. Establishing a bond has been shown capable to stimulate the patient confidence regarding the professional.
